#d35503 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d35503 is composed of 82.7% red, 33.3%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 59.7% magenta, 98.6%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 23.7 degrees, a saturation of 97.2% and a lightness of 42%. #d35503 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ffaa06 with #a70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#d35503 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d35503 has RGB values of R:211, G:85,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.6, Y:0.99,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13849859.

Shades and Tints of #d35503
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120700 is the darkest color, while #fffefd is the lightest one.
